What is FFMI (Fat-Free Mass Index)?
- Definition: FFMI measures muscle mass relative to height, similar to BMI but excluding fat
- Formula: FFMI = Fat-Free Mass (kg) ÷ Height² (m)
- Purpose: Evaluates muscle development independent of body fat
- Advantage: Better indicator of muscularity than standard BMI
- Applications: Fitness, bodybuilding, sports medicine, health assessment
FFMI Standards by Gender
Men's FFMI Categories
- Low (< 16): Insufficient muscle mass, below average
- Normal (16-18): Average muscle mass for untrained individuals
- Good (18-20): Above average muscle mass, regular training evident
- Excellent (20-22): Excellent muscle development, experienced athlete level
- Elite (22-25): Elite muscle mass, result of years of intensive training
- Extreme (> 25): Exceptional level, often beyond natural genetic limits
Women's FFMI Categories
- Low (< 14): Insufficient muscle mass, below average
- Normal (14-16): Average muscle mass for untrained individuals
- Good (16-17): Above average muscle mass, regular training evident
- Excellent (17-18): Excellent muscle development, experienced athlete level
- Elite (18-20): Elite muscle mass, result of years of intensive training
- Extreme (> 20): Exceptional level, often beyond natural genetic limits

Realistic FFMI Development Timeline
- First Year: +2-4 FFMI points possible
- Second Year: +1-2 FFMI points
- Third Year+: +0.5-1 FFMI point annually
- Genetic Limit: Usually reached within 3-5 years
- Natural Male Limit: FFMI 22-25
- Natural Female Limit: FFMI 18-20
FFMI vs BMI Comparison
- BMI: Considers total body weight (muscle + fat)
- FFMI: Considers only fat-free mass (muscle, organs, bones)
- Accuracy: FFMI better reflects muscle development
- Application: FFMI superior for athletes and fitness enthusiasts
- Limitation: FFMI requires body fat percentage measurement
Body Fat Measurement Methods
- Bioimpedance: Accessible, moderate accuracy
- Skinfold Calipers: Inexpensive, requires skill
- DEXA Scan: Very accurate, expensive
- Underwater Weighing: Accurate, rarely available
- BOD POD: Accurate, expensive
- MRI/CT: Most accurate, very expensive

Frequently Asked Questions
What is FFMI and how is it different from BMI?
FFMI (Fat-Free Mass Index) measures muscle mass relative to height, while BMI includes both muscle and fat. FFMI is more useful for athletes and bodybuilders since it distinguishes between muscle and fat weight. A high BMI could indicate muscle mass (good) or excess fat (concerning), but FFMI clarifies this distinction.
What are normal FFMI ranges for men and women?
For men: 16-17 (below average), 18-20 (average), 21-23 (above average), 24-25 (excellent). For women: 13-14 (below average), 15-16 (average), 17-18 (above average), 19-20 (excellent). Values above 25 for men or 22 for women are rare without exceptional genetics or performance-enhancing substances.
Can FFMI help determine if someone is using steroids?
FFMI can provide clues but isn't definitive proof. Natural males rarely exceed FFMI of 25, and natural females rarely exceed 22. However, exceptional genetics, training, and nutrition can produce higher values naturally. FFMI should be considered alongside other factors, not used as sole evidence.
How accurate is the FFMI calculator?
The calculator provides estimates based on formulas and population data, typically accurate within reasonable ranges for most people. However, it requires accurate body fat percentage, which can be difficult to measure precisely. Professional body composition testing (DEXA, hydrostatic weighing) provides more accurate results.

Is there an upper limit to natural FFMI?
Research suggests natural limits around FFMI 25 for men and 22 for women, though rare individuals may exceed these naturally. Factors include genetics, training age, nutrition, and body structure. These limits help distinguish between natural and potentially enhanced physiques in competitive contexts.
How does age affect FFMI?
FFMI typically peaks in the 20s-30s and gradually declines with age due to natural muscle loss (sarcopenia). However, resistance training can maintain or even increase FFMI well into older age. Older adults who strength train can have higher FFMI than sedentary younger people.
